Male Breast Reduction in Tampa Florida


Breasts in males are called genycomastia, a Greek word meaning "breasts looking similar to women's". 40-60% of men have breasts; many conditions can cause this phenomenon like medication and medical problems (alcohol use, marihuana and steroids), but in most of the cases the reason is not known. It can damage self-confidence and self esteem, therefore breast reduction can help.

The ideal candidates for the operation are men with genicomastia for at least a year long who have developed chest muscles and elastic skin. The surgery is not recommended for overweight men who can't loose weight using diet and exercise.

In case of extra breast tissue the surgeon will remove it through an invisible cut around the nipple or below the breast fold. Sometimes extra fat also removed using this method; the canula used for suction of the fat is inserted through the cut already made. When there is extra skin needs to be removed, the procedure may leave bigger scars.

If the extra tissue is fat, liposuction is performed. The cuts, 5-7 millimeters long, are made at the margins of the breast, from below and from the side. Sometimes small cut is made around the nipple. You may feel a vibration sensation, but no pain, if the procedure is done using local anesthetics. In extreme cases when there is large amounts of fat and tissue extracted, the extra skin needs to be removed, then a drainage tube usually left to prevent fluid collection.

Finally, incisions are closed and pressure bandages are placed.

Every operation has its risks. The risks include infection, bleeding, fluid collection, breast asymmetry (that needs to be corrected in additional surgery), scars, nipple distortion and permanent color changes of the skin.

After the surgery you may feel uncomfortable, regardless of the technique used. It can be treated with painkillers. Swelling and hemorrhage may appear in the area, to reduce the swelling you'll be instructed to wear a tight bandage around the chest for several weeks day and night. The breast will reach their final size in 3 month or so. You'll be able to go back to work after a week or two. It is advised to restrain from sexual activity or physical efforts for at least 2 weeks, and any activity that may harm the chest for a month. It's important to avoid sunlight to your chest for 6 month to prevent color changes in the breast.

  • Tampa Understand

    Tampa is situated on the north shore of Tampa Bay in west Central Florida. Saint Petersburg lies west of the bay, while Bradenton is on the southern shore. The downtown business center of town is on the north shore of Hillsborough Bay (a small bay within Tampa Bay which is bordered by the eastern shore of Tampa Bay and the small peninsula of South Tampa) and Ybor City lies just to the east. MacDill Air Force Base is on the southern tip of South Tampa, while the city also extends to the north all the way to the newly incorporated area of New Tampa.

  • BioSpace has reported briefly on Phase III data for retigabine, a first-in-class neuronal potassium channel opener which is in development as an adjunct in the treatment of adult epilepsy patients with refractory partial-onset seizures. The double-blind trial – RESTORE 1 (Retigabine Efficacy and Safety Trials for Partial Onset Epilepsy) – randomised 306 adults who were experiencing refractory partial-onset seizures despite receiving stable doses of up to three anti-epileptics to additional treatment with retigabine (400mg TDS; n=151) or placebo (n=150). Study duration was 32 weeks including 8 weeks baseline phase, 6 weeks titration phase, 12 weeks maintenance phase and 6 weeks transition phase. Only brief details of the study are included in the BioSpace abstract which prevents a full evaluation of the findings; however the following results were reported: • The median reduction in 28-day total partial seizure frequency was 44.3% in the retigabine group and 17.5% in the placebo group (p<0.0001) • The median reduction in 28-day total partial seizure frequency during the maintenance phase was 54.5% versus 18.9%, respectively (p<0.0001) • The responder rate (at least a 50% reduction in 28-day total partial seizure frequency) was 45.0% versus 18.0%, respectively (p<0.0001) • The responder rate during the maintenance phase was 55.5% versus 22.6%, respectively (p<0.0001) Results from RESTORE 2, the second pivotal Phase III clinical trial studying lower doses of retigabine, are expected during the second quarter of 2008. The company anticipate filing a Marketing Authorization Application (MAA) to the EMEA before the end of the year.
